As the popularity of vaping continues to rise, many travelers may wonder about the regulations regarding bringing vape devices and e-liquids to airports, particularly in the Philippines. With its beautiful beaches and vibrant culture, the Philippines attracts numerous tourists each year, and understanding the rules about vaping can make your journey smoother.
Firstly, it is essential to note that the Philippines has specific guidelines concerning vaping products. The Department of Health (DOH) and other regulatory bodies oversee the sale and use of vaping devices, so it’s crucial to be informed before you travel. For international travelers, bringing vape products to the Philippines is generally permissible, but there are certain restrictions and best practices you should follow.
When packing your vape, ensure that you place it in your carry-on luggage rather than in checked baggage. This is not only a precautionary measure for safety reasons—since vape batteries can pose a risk if damaged—but it also allows for easier access during security checks. Be sure to keep your vape device turned off and packed securely to prevent accidental activation.
Regarding e-liquids, the Philippine authorities typically allow travelers to bring a limited quantity. It is advisable to carry e-liquids in containers that are no larger than 100 milliliters (ml) each, and to ensure that the total volume does not exceed 1 liter, in line with international regulations for transporting liquids. Additionally, consider carrying the original packaging of your products, as this can help clarify their intended use during inspections.
Upon arriving in the Philippines, it is important to research and respect local laws regarding vaping. Cities like Manila and Cebu have specific areas designated for smoking and vaping, and violating these regulations can result in fines or other penalties. Furthermore, some establishments may have their own rules against vaping inside, so always ask before lighting up.
